Using A Baby Care Checklist
Having a baby is a wonderful and exiting time in a couple’s life. The baby will bring a whole new chapter into the life of the parents and will become one of the major reasons for every decision that is made by the parents. Every aspect of life will become more complicated and will need to be planned and well thought out. One thing that can help to keep things simple is for the parents to use baby care checklists. There are a variety of baby care checklists that can be used for all different purposes to help the parents and other caregivers in the preparation and care of the infant.
Baby Care Checklist For The Nursery
As the birth of the infant approaches the parents will find that a baby care checklist can help in preparing the nursery and home for the arrival. First time parents, especially, will be amazed at how many things are needed in the nursery. Everything from the crib to the basic health care supplies will need to be purchased in advance of the baby’s arrival. Using a baby care checklist will insure that no essential items are forgotten. The parents can create their own list for nursery items with the help of family, friends and books or they can use a list found on the internet or from parenting resources.
First Timers Baby Care Checklist
For first time parents a baby care checklist can be a great resource to make sure that every area of care is being addressed by the parents. Although most of the care of the infant will be evident, new parents may be very nervous and will find comfort in using a checklist to help them know that have done everything they need to do for the infant. The baby care checklist can also provide the parents with a place to record feedings, diaper changes and other vital information. This information can be used by the parents and the pediatrician to see that the baby’s needs are being met.
Caregiver’s Baby Care Checklist
Another great use for a baby care checklist is when the infant is left in the care of a babysitter. By creating a caregiver’s baby care checklist for the babysitter the parents can help the babysitter know and understand the needs of their child. The babysitter can use the checklist to insure that all feedings and care needs have been met and they can record all the information of the care for the parents. Then when the parents resume care of the infant they will have a quick history of how much the baby ate and when the last diaper change was. This will help the consistency of care to be maintained as the transition of caregivers takes place.
